CBRE to Be Leasing Agent for 300 New Jersey in D.C.
May 8, 2008

CB Richard Ellis Inc. has announced local real estate investor and developer Ralph Dweck selected the firm to handle leasing for Washington, D.C.’s 300 New Jersey Ave., N.W. The 10 story, 255,000-rentable-square-foot building is expected to deliver second quarter 2009. Mr. Dweck, who recently purchased the property from JBG, has called on CBRE to lease approximately 100,000 square feet. The entire project, bounded by Louisiana avenue, New Jersey Ave., D Street and F Street N.W., will be renamed America’s Square.

merrill Exclusive: Harrison Street Closes on $430M Equity Fund
Chicago-based Harrison Street Real Capital has closed on a new private equity fund after raising about $430 million. Harrison Street Real Estate Partners II L.P., as the fund is known, began raising capital in March. There are more than 40 investors in the fund, including both domestic and European pension funds, insurance companies, endowments and foundations. One particularly large participant, the Arizona Public Safety Pension Retirement System, has committed $80 million to the fund, including an additional $45 million for co-investments.
